How they compare

Mauritius currently reports 2.0% against 1.6% in Saint Vincent and the Grenadines, a difference of 0.4%.

That makes Mauritius's figure about 1.2 times Saint Vincent and the Grenadines's.

The two have swapped places 6 times across 24 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Mauritius ahead.

Mauritius ranks 91st and Saint Vincent and the Grenadines ranks 93rd of 194 countries.

Saint Vincent and the Grenadines has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Mauritius Saint Vincent and the Grenadines Difference Ahead
2000s 0.4% 1.1% 0.7% Saint Vincent and the Grenadines
2010s 1.4% 2.4% 1.0% Saint Vincent and the Grenadines
2020s 2.0% 2.1% 0.1% Saint Vincent and the Grenadines

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
